Assignment Description :
For this task, we are required to create a brief audio adaptation of a fairy tale. We can either choose a classic story or write an original one. Based on the selected storyline, we need to record narration and voice acting for the characters.
After recording, the audio should be edited in Adobe Audition to enhance clarity, and appropriate sound effects and background music should be added to create atmosphere. The final audio will then be paired with a set of visual images or illustrations.
The finished piece should be aroundtwo minutes long, with a focus on telling a complete story purely through sound.

Voice Recording :
I condensed La Luna into a 2.5-minute storyline by summarizing the key points of the original short film. I then added narration along with scripted dialogue between the main character, his father, and grandfather. To bring the real, I asked my friend to voice the father and grandfather roles.
Process :
I first imported the recorded audio clips into Adobe Audition in sequence. Then, I applied a denoise effect to the voice recordings to reduce any background noise that might have occurred during the recording process.
After reducing the background noise, I used EQ to shape the voice tone by slightly boosting the lower frequencies to add warmth and depth, and reducing some of the harsh high-mid frequencies to make the narration sound smoother. I then manually adjusted a few volume spikes to match the overall loudness, and applied the Dynamics effect to compress the audio for a more consistent volume across all words.
Based on the original atmosphere of La Luna, I added background music to enhance the storytelling mood and placed sound effects at key moments to emphasize important narrative beats. To maintain a smooth and pleasant listening experience, I applied fade-in and fade-out effects to both the background music and sound effects, allowing them to blend naturally with the voice narration.
After finishing the audio editing, I exported the final track and imported it into a video editing software to synchronize it with the images. I added fade-in and fade-out animations to the images to match the pacing and transitions of the audio, creating a smoothe viewing experience.
